Login fails on Android unless using "demo customer" email

Description
Describe the bug
When attempting to log in through email on Android, users are unable to log in unless they use the "demo customer" email. Any other email address results in an error message.
To Reproduce
Steps to reproduce the behavior:
Open the app on a Samsung Galaxy A15 (Android)
Go to the login screen
Enter any email address other than "demo customer"
Attempt to log in
See error message
Expected behavior
The login should accept any valid user email, not just the "demo customer" email.

Additional context
This issue seems to be specific to Android. The login works fine on iOS (e.g., iPhone 13 Pro Max). The problem could be related to platform-specific login handling or authentication checks.
